I paid $286 at my dealer and do not even think it was worth it. Buddy told me they just check fluids, oil change, change the cabin filter. You can have them do the oil change and you can buy the cabin filters from one of the sponsors here and save a ton of money. The dealer also mentioned something about adjusting the parking brake but I can't tell the difference.
